Durable Materials Built to Last
One of the most important features of a premium outdoor planter is the material used in its construction.
Outdoor environments expose planters to rain, snow, wind, UV rays, temperature fluctuations, and constant moisture. Inferior materials may crack, warp, rot, or fade over time, resulting in costly replacements and diminished curb appeal.
Premium planters are typically constructed from materials engineered for long-term outdoor performance, including:
- Powder-coated aluminum
- Heavy-gauge steel
- Marine-grade finishes for enhanced protection
Aluminum is especially popular because it naturally resists corrosion while remaining lightweight enough for easier handling and installation. Powder-coated finishes are used to add durable color and are resistant to scratches, fading, and everyday wear.
Choosing weather-resistant materials ensures your planter maintains both its structural integrity and attractive appearance through changing seasons.
Proper Drainage Supports Healthy Plants
Even the most beautiful planter cannot compensate for poor drainage.
Healthy plants depend on proper water management to prevent root rot, fungal growth, and overly saturated soil. A premium outdoor planter should include drainage features designed to promote healthy root systems while protecting the planter itself from standing water.
Look for planters that include:
- Optional bottom pans with built-in drainage holes
- Drainage sleeves or fittings
- Optional irrigation compatibility
- Water management systems for larger installations
Effective drainage helps maintain the right soil moisture levels while allowing excess water to escape after rain or watering. This not only supports healthier plants but also reduces stress on the planter over time.
When paired with quality soil and appropriate watering practices, a well-designed drainage system contributes to long-lasting landscape success.
Superior Craftsmanship Makes a Difference
Not all metal planters are manufactured to the same standards.
Premium craftsmanship affects everything from durability to visual appeal. Weld quality, structural reinforcement, edge finishing, and overall precision all influence how well a planter performs over the years.
Features that demonstrate quality craftsmanship include:
- Fully welded construction
- Reinforced internal supports
- Clean, consistent seams
- Precision fabrication
- Smooth powder-coated finishes
Well-built planters resist warping, maintain their shape, and provide a polished appearance that complements upscale outdoor environments.

Low-Maintenance Performance
One advantage of investing in a premium planter is reduced maintenance.
High-quality finishes resist fading, corrosion, and weather-related deterioration, allowing homeowners and property managers to spend less time maintaining containers and more time enjoying their outdoor spaces.
Routine maintenance generally involves:
- Occasional removal of hard water deposits
- Seasonal drainage inspections
- Checking for minor wear
Unlike wood planters that require staining or plastic containers that become brittle over time, premium metal planters maintain their appearance with relatively little upkeep.
